In my lecture on mathematical logic, we delve into the fundamental principles that form the backbone of logical reasoning in mathematics. We explore the structure of formal languages, the syntax and semantics of logical systems, and the distinction between propositional and predicate logic. By understanding how formal proofs are constructed, we examine the concepts of consistency, completeness, and soundness within logical frameworks. Additionally, we discuss how mathematical logic serves as the foundation for areas such as set theory, computability, and complexity theory, providing a crucial toolset for both theoretical research and practical applications in computer science, mathematics, and philosophy.
